After 10 Years, Energy Recovery Still Delivers For Atlanta Building
Energy cost savings, plenty of fresh air, really simple maintenance, solid-gold reliability - these are the actual benefits of an energy recovery system installed 10 years ago in an Atlanta office building, according to the equipment operator. Although the energy recovery system was originally designed to improve indoor air quality, the unit has proved that it can do much more by decreasing humidity, dramatically reducing the building's cooling energy consumption, and running reliably, day after day, year after year.
"To be honest, as simple and basic as this equipment is, I don't see why it couldn't last 20 or 25 years," said David Walker, the office building's technical services manager.
